What separates artisanal white chocolate from industrial simulacra is the unwavering commitment to process integrity. Unlike mass-produced variants that often rely on stabilizers and homogenized emulsifiers to mask inconsistencies, true craft centers on a three-phase schema: **Cocoa Butter Purity, Sugar Dispersion, and Milk Integration**. Each phase demands not just technique, but an intuitive grasp of fat behavior and crystallization kinetics.

  • Cocoa Butter Purity is nonnegotiable. Artisans source beans with low free fatty acid content—typically under 1.5%—ensuring the fat matrix remains clean and malleable. This purity prevents off-flavors and enables a velvety melt, a hallmark of premium white chocolate. Empirical data from Swiss and Belgian master chocolatiers show that butter with high oleic acid content—around 70–75%—enhances smoothness by reducing crystallization instability. This isn’t just a preference; it’s a physical necessity.
  • Sugar Dispersion requires meticulous attention. Refined sugar is introduced not as a bulk ingredient, but as a finely milled powder, often blended with invert sugar to limit graininess and accelerate dissolution. The key insight? Sugar must integrate uniformly without forming clumps, a balance achieved through gentle, high-shear mixing at precisely controlled temperatures—typically between 28°C to 32°C. Too hot, and the cocoa butter emulsifies prematurely; too cold, and crystallization stalls. The result? A homogenous dispersion that melts evenly on the tongue.
  • Milk Integration introduces another layer of complexity. Artisanal producers opt for fresh, high-quality milk—whether dried, ultra-pasteurized, or fresh—whose proteins and sugars must bind seamlessly with the cocoa butter matrix. The critical temperature here is 38°C: above this, milk proteins denature, losing their ability to stabilize the fat blend; below, emulsification falters. The best artisans avoid stabilizers, trusting the natural synergy between milk’s casein and sugar’s hygroscopicity. The outcome? A silkier mouthfeel, richer in complexity, free of artificial aftertaste.

Beyond ingredient precision lies the *tempering dance*—a thermal protocol that governs cocoa butter crystallization. Artisanal methods favor controlled cooling cycles, often using marble slabs or precision tempering machines set to 27°C for seed formation, followed by a final warm-up to 31°C. This staged approach promotes the stable Form V crystals, responsible for snap, shine, and resistance to bloom. Industrial processes, by contrast, often skip this rigor, substituting with emulsifiers like lecithin to mimic stability—an elegant shortcut that sacrifices long-term texture integrity.
